Most people purchase cars outright … WebOct 4, 2024 · Most dealers limit the amount they’ll take on a credit card at $5,000, or at most $10,000, says Randy Henrick, auto finance consultant and president of Auto Dealer Compliance. A luxury vehicle dealer – think Acura, Lexus or Maserati – might be more likely to let you buy an entire car on a card than a mainstream one, Henrick says.
